The very high infection figures despite the lockdown and the still unclear impact of the currently rapidly spreading virus mutations make it so unlikely that the theaters and concert halls will be open in the coming weeks and months that Berlin's Senator for Culture, Klaus Lederer, together with the artistic directors, has agreed to extend the closure phase until Easter.
In the meantime, we continue to stream current and historical recordings of the Schaubühne's theater performances. You will find the dates of the respective streams in grey in the schedule.
